Abstract

This study aims to directly understand how the role of commission as a motivating factor for employees in finding customers to achieve closing at PT. Agrodana Futures. The commission system implemented by the company is not only given once at the time of closing or opening a customer account but is also given repeatedly every time a customer makes a transaction activity. The method used in this study is descriptive qualitative with data collection techniques through direct observation and documentation during the internship period. The results of the study indicate that the commission system provides a significant boost to employee enthusiasm and work motivation, especially in prospecting and follow-up activities for prospective customers. Employees who have active customers and receive regular commissions tend to show more stable performance and high initiative in maintaining relationships with customers. The commission also creates a competitive and collaborative work atmosphere through activities such as morning briefings and monthly top commission distribution. However, challenges remain, such as customers who do not understand the risks and mechanisms in futures trading and require an educational approach and personal communication from employees. Therefore, company support in the form of training and provision of educational materials is needed to maintain the sustainability of the commission system and customer loyalty.
